What is a Speed of Sound (Air, 20°C)?

The Speed of Sound is the distance travelled per unit of time by a sound wave as it propagates through an elastic medium. At 20°C in dry air, it is 343 m/s.

What is a Kilometer per Hour?

The Kilometer per Hour (km/h) is a unit of speed used in various measurement systems.

How to Convert Speed of Sound (Air, 20°C) to Kilometer per Hour

To convert Speed of Sound (Air, 20°C) to Kilometer per Hour, multiply the Speed of Sound (Air, 20°C) value by 1234.8.

km/h = Ma × 1234.8
